--- name: spec-pipeline description: "Executes the full dev-to-docs pipeline: Developer -> Tester -> Writer." --- ## What I do I orchestrate a sequential feature implementation and verification pipeline: 1. **Architect**: Explores codebase, asks clarifying questions, and drafts the spec. *Waits for user approval before handoff.* 2. **Developer**: Implements the feature based on the spec. 3. **Tester**: Runs full unit test suites; repairs failures if found. 4. **Writer**: After updating README and API docs, review `docs/tech_debt_and_optimizations.md` for formatting consistency and ensure no duplicate entries exist. ## Execution Rules - **Architect Gate**: Stop after Phase 3 and wait for user approval on the spec before calling `@developer`. - **Tester Repair Limit**: Allow `@tester` a maximum of 2 auto-repair attempts for failing test suites. If tests still fail after 2 attempts, hand the error context back to `@developer` to fix the underlying implementation. - Stop and ask the user for clarification if any step fails or is ambiguous. - Use `@` mentions to trigger subagents sequentially. - Pass context from each completed stage to the next stage. ## When to use me Invoke me when you are ready to begin a new feature/fix or when the Architect has finished a specification.
